          $150 for a refret with SS is dirt cheap! If he does good work, stay with him.

          I, for one, LOVE SS frets. Smooth & glassy bends. No wear that I can see. And no difference in tone, or at least "no audible difference on my guitar after swapping Carvin necks in which the only difference was the frets, with my rig and my hearing and auditory memory".
